📖 Biblical Background
Vultures appear several times throughout Scripture, usually in contexts involving judgment, desolation, or the aftermath of battle.
In biblical times, vultures played an important role in the ecosystem by removing dead animals from the land. Although they were considered unclean birds under Old Testament law (Leviticus 11:13), their presence served a practical purpose within God’s creation.
Jesus also referred to vultures when teaching about discernment and the certainty of future events:
“Wherever there is a carcass, there the vultures will gather.” (Matthew 24:28)
This statement emphasized that certain signs naturally reveal underlying realities. Just as vultures gather where something has died, spiritual conditions often reveal themselves through visible evidence.
Therefore, the biblical view of vultures is not centered on fear but on understanding God’s principles of justice, truth, and spiritual awareness.

Are vultures considered evil in the Bible?
No. While vultures were classified as unclean birds under Old Testament law, they were still part of God’s creation.
The Bible never teaches that vultures are evil or possess supernatural powers.
